Basic Information (Description):
The BA in Ethnicity, Race, and First Nation Studies is a very unique program. The curriculum focuses on a comparative and comprehensive study of diversity in terms of ethnicity, race, and first nations. Students are required to enroll in an internship program in communities near the university. Courses focus on how different races, ethnicities, and nations shape literatures, policies, communities, and people’s identities in the US and internationally as well. The program is very comprehensive and peculiar, in the sense that it focuses on race and ethnicity, but also on the first nation concept.
